This position is (55%) recruiting tasks involving candidate sourcing, profile writing, editing, and talent coordination duties, (20%) candidate tracking, systems and project management, (15%) candidate scheduling and phone/email recruiting coordination, and (10%) communications and project work. This is a full-time position starts fully remote because of Covid 19 and is based in our downtown Portland, Oregon office long term.

Key position responsibilities: 

  • Work with and directly support a dynamic, busy team leading important searches that help national nonprofit organizations, foundations, and local corporate clients find exceptional staff.
  • Create proposal for new clients and write compelling candidate descriptions and presentations. 
  • Help source amazing talent and work with incredible clients.
  • Help organize/project manage related work being completed.
  • Help build talent pipelines and rank candidates.
  • Work with executive candidates and help Scion to find exceptional talent for our clients.
  • Schedule and organize calendars for searches/prospects.
  • Check references of executive candidates.
  • Write and edit candidate profiles/presentations.
  • Edit and proofread emails and documents.
  • Create files, labels, and systems.
  • Track, review, and manage executive candidates.
  • Order supplies and run minor errands to support the office.
  • Various administrative tasks and projects.
  • Manage projects and timelines.

Salary and Benefits:

This position starts as a full-time role with competitive base salary and fully paid individual health (including health, vision and dental) coverage. The starting base pay salary ranges from $48,000 to $55,000 DOE, plus makes additional commissions on the search you support on after 90 days, and has annually salary reviews and raises.  We grow our staff's compensation over time and this position has very strong room for growth for motivated professionals. This position also provides benefits including sick time, vacation time, office holidays, your birthday off, 401k, and the opportunity to learn from an amazing and expert team in a passionate industry-leading firm.
